Baton Rouge Health Care Center (BATON ROUGE, LA) — $203,721 in CMS Fines
Outcome: Baton Rouge Health Care Center in BATON ROUGE, LA was fined $203,721 by CMS across 3 separate penalties following 17 deficiency citations identified during federal surveys.
Deficiency areas cited:
- Safeguard resident-identifiable information and/or maintain medical records on each resident that are in accordance with accepted professional standards.
- Reasonably accommodate the needs and preferences of each resident.
- Develop and implement a complete care plan that meets all the resident's needs, with timetables and actions that can be measured.
- Ensure services provided by the nursing facility meet professional standards of quality.
-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ents.
- Implement gradual dose reductions(GDR) and non-pharmacological interventions, unless contraindicated, prior to initiating or instead of continuing psychotropic medication; and PRN orders for psychotropic medications are only used when the medication is necessary and PRN use is limited.
- Honor the resident's right to a dignified existence, self-determination, communication, and to exercise his or her rights.
- Keep residents' personal and medical records private and confidential.
